Key Differences
Pros of Mediatek Dimensity 1080
- Dimensity 1080 has 18.18% higher CPU clock speed than Dimensity 6100 Plus (2600 vs 2200 MHz).
- Dimensity 1080 has 50.02% higher memory frequency than Dimensity 6100 Plus (3200 vs 2133 MHz).
- Dimensity 1080 has 43.03% better AnTuTu 9 score than Dimensity 6100 Plus (517 K vs 361 K).
- Dimensity 1080 Support 58.17% higher memory bandwidth than Dimensity 6100 Plus (27 vs 17.07 MHz).
